Job Description

As a Senior Platform Engineer in the Cloud PaaS team , you will contribute to the development, delivery and operation of a modern self-service Kubernetes platform, which serves the needs of hundreds of developers across numerous application teams. Enabling Sainsbury\’s to deliver a great shopping experience to 20M customers a week, in as fast, safe and efficient way possible.

It is the PaaS\’ team\’s responsibility to build and operate a compelling internal Platform product, ensuring we offer capabilities to meet the needs of our customers; the application teams. We leverage many modern cloud native technologies as part of our PaaS product, including; EKS, Helm, Istio, Flux, Terraform and GitHub Actions (to name a few) but we aim to make technology choices that complement our existing ecosystem and crucially add value, not because they are new and shiny.

More about the role

  1. You\’ll be part of a team that owns the architecture, development and operation of a large-scale PaaS responsible for hosting containerised workloads in the cloud.
  2. You\’ll work with the team to implement the product technical roadmap for Sainsbury\’s strategic PaaS.
  3. You\’ll work with technologies at Enterprise scale.
  4. You may be asked to participate in out of hours support and should aim to build reliability and fault tolerance into the product, as well as engineering systems that are simple to diagnose and fix.
  5. You\’ll guide, support and enable performance within the team through providing technical knowledge and ideas.

More about you

  1. Great expertise in modern Cloud engineering practices, including deep knowledge of system architecture, reliability engineering and DevOps principles.
  2. Proven experience of cloud architecture, container orchestration, infrastructure as code and CI/CD.
  3. Proven ability to write code in one or more of our core languages (Typescript, Go, Python, Bash).
  4. Self-driven and constantly striving to improve your team, division and peers.
  5. Drive for advocacy of agile/lean delivery methodologies.
  6. A passion for delivering solutions to customers, owning the whole SDLC and living the DevSecOps principles.
  7. Ideally, prior experience of developing and operating a self-service Platform-as-a-Service.
  8. A passion for enhancing your knowledge and evidence of curiosity in emerging tech.
  9. Display pragmatism, empathy and understanding when interacting with team, stakeholders and customers.

Technologies we use

  1. AWS
  2. Kubernetes (EKS)
  3. Istio
  4. Terraform
  5. Flux
  6. Crossplane
  7. Helm
  8. ELK / EFK
  9. Hashicorp Vault
  10. GitHub Actions
  11. Prometheus / Thanos / Grafana
  12. New Relic
  13. Kafka
  14. OPA Gatekeeper
  15. Typescript, Go, Python, Bash
